Activism, so essential to countering the rampant destruction of our common life by big money, has been shifting gradually from a self-sacrificing mindset with burnout tendencies, to one that values joy, self-care, community, and solidarity. This shift also emphasizes the many ways that activism can engage each person’s unique skills and creativity. In this highly participatory circle, we will be inspired by various examples of this shift, especially from black feminism; practice skills that can make activism more sustainable; and support each other to step out of passivity into nurturing engagement.
We’ll be led in this workshop by Elan Shapiro, who has been involved with various forms of activism, psycho-spiritual practice and conscious community for the past 50 years. Elan’s educational programs focus on drawing out people’s wisdom through creative reflection and small group support.
